Line twist has always been an inherent problem with spinning reels, along with the occasional backlash and wind knot that is caused by line being loosely packed onto the spool. While most spinning reel anglers have come to just expect these problems, we address them with the new Propulsion Line Management System. Shimano Stella FD no more line twist.

A five-component system, Shimano’s Propulsion feature includes a spool lip design to prevent backlashes and wind knots from forming. Line also flows off the spool in smaller loops meaning less line slap on the stripper guide, which when combined with the long stroke spool design, provides longer casting distance due to less friction. The unique shape of the spool and the spool lip design combine to keep the line from bouncing, and provides a consistent light friction on the line to reduce line twist and backlashes.

The Propulsion Line Management System also includes Shimano’s SR-Concept one-piece bail wire to reduce friction and tangles, a twist-reducing Power Roller III line roller, a bail trip mechanism that easily trips the bail by turning the handle, and Shimano’s S-Arm Cam. This final component keeps the line in contact with the line roller during slack line fishing such as vertical jigging and drop-shotting.

The Shimano Stella FD reels also feature Shimano’s Aero Wrap II Oscillation System to provide uniform line lay and winding shape. This special worm gear system creates the ideal line lay for the Propulsion spool lip design, preventing any loss of energy during the cast while providing longer casting distance.

Additionally, the Shimano Stella FD reels feature Shimano’s new Rigid Support System. Building upon the Stella FB introduction of Rigid Support Drag to eliminate spool wobble at light drag settings, the Rigid Support System adds a redesigned oscillation slider to eliminate axial spool play as well. By eliminating these tolerances drag performance is even smoother and more efficient than in previous Stella reels.

Shimano Fishing Reels are products of the Shimano Fishing Tackle Company.

The company began business in 1921 under the name of Shimano Ironworks and their product was a bicycle freewheel. Through the years up until 1970 their main focus was on bicycle production. In 1970 the fishing tackle division was introduced and by 1978 the company starts a fishing tackle campaign. This was the year that the series of Bantam reels were released. In 1981 the X Line series of rods were released. Conventional reels include reels for the saltwater angler such as the Trinidad DC. This reel is an exceptional choice for saltwater anglers due to it’s digital braking system. With an 8 step adjustment knob you can control the mode of the reel from an ultra long cast mode to a maximum control mode.

The Tekota reel is a conventional reel that is great for both freshwater fish and saltwater fish. Saltwater anglers will appreciate its strength and durability while the freshwater angler will appreciate its line capacity.

Spinning reels that Shimano Fishing Reels offers include the Spirex FG. This reel was designed for simple one handed casts and has A-RB bearings which produces a smooth retrieval of the line. The Sahara would be the choice for light saltwater fishing or freshwater fishing. The line capacity and many features this reel has to offer makes it the reel for offshore fishing. The Stella FD has a magnesium frame and an aluminum rotor which makes this reel light weight and durable. It also has a gear coating on top of the normal gear coating that will ensure the durability of this spinning reel.
